Subject: [PATCH] io_uring: drop the old style inflight file tracking
Git-commit: d5361233e9ab920e135819f73dd8466355f1fddd
Patch-mainline: v5.18-rc2
References: bsc#1205205

io_uring tracks requests that are referencing an io_uring descriptor to
be able to cancel without worrying about loops in the references. Since
we now assign the file at execution time, the easier approach is to drop
a potentially problematic reference before we punt the request. This
eliminates the need to special case these types of files beyond just
marking them as such, and simplifies cancelation quite a bit.

This also fixes a recent issue where an async punted tee operation would
with the io_uring descriptor as the output file would crash when
attempting to get a reference to the file from the io-wq worker. We
could have worked around that, but this is the much cleaner fix.
